#7f7ef2 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#7f7ef2 is composed of 49.8% red, 49.4%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.5% cyan, 47.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 240.5 degrees, a saturation of 81.7% and a lightness of 72.2%. #7f7ef2 color hex could be obtained by blending #fefcff with #0000e5.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

● #7f7ef2 color description : Soft blue.
The hexadecimal color #7f7ef2 has RGB values of R:127, G:126,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.48,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 8355570.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01010e is the darkest color, while #fbfbff is the lightest one.
